Can Executive Actions Restore Confidence After Employee’s Crimes?

The recent arrest of a former Nomura Holdings employee accused of robbery, arson, and attempted murder has sent shockwaves through the financial institution, prompting immediate and substantial actions from the company’s highest echelons. In light of these serious allegations, Nomura Holdings’ CEO Kentaro Okuda, along with other top executives, has decided to take a voluntary pay cut to acknowledge the gravity of the incident and express their commitment to rectifying the situation. This decisive move reflects the company’s dedication to rebuilding trust and demonstrating accountability to its clients and stakeholders.

Immediate Corrective Actions and Communication with Clients

Statement of Apology and Investigation Initiation

Nomura Holdings issued an official statement expressing their heartfelt apologies to the clients affected by the former employee’s criminal activities and to anyone disturbed by the incident. The firm emphasized their commitment to restoring confidence and immediately reached out to the clients who had interactions with the accused employee. An extensive investigation was promptly initiated to identify any other possible misconduct that might have been overlooked. The former employee was subjected to disciplinary dismissal on August 4, 2024, underscoring the firm’s zero-tolerance policy toward such egregious behavior.

The company’s leadership has made it clear that such actions are not reflective of Nomura’s values or ethical standards. They are proactively seeking to uncover any additional malfeasance that could potentially undermine their integrity and reputation. This incident has also served as a catalyst for the firm to reflect on their existing protocols and make necessary revisions to prevent similar occurrences in the future. By taking immediate action and communicating transparently with their clients, Nomura Holdings aims to mitigate the damage and move forward with a renewed focus on ethical conduct and client security.

Enhanced Measures to Prevent Employee Misconduct

Recognizing the critical need for more robust deterrents against individual employee misconduct, Nomura Holdings has introduced rigorous measures designed to strengthen supervision and ethical compliance within the firm. One of the primary strategies includes enhanced monitoring of employees’ business activities, particularly those that involve direct interaction with clients. By strictly managing work schedules and utilizing advanced technologies such as data from company-issued mobile phones and dashboard cameras, the firm aims to detect and address suspicious behavior in its early stages.

Moreover, Nomura Holdings is implementing a "block leave" policy for employees, requiring them to take a continuous leave period annually. This approach is intended to uncover any potential malpractices that might occur in an employee’s absence. Additionally, the company plans to conduct regular one-on-one meetings with employees to ensure clear communication and address any ethical concerns that arise. These measures signify Nomura’s commitment to maintaining a safe and trustworthy environment for both clients and employees alike.

Structural Reforms and Ethical Training Initiatives

Revising Evaluation Processes and Conducting Training

In the wake of this alarming incident, Nomura Holdings has recognized the need to overhaul its evaluation processes to better align with ethical standards. The firm’s leadership is prioritizing the revision of their employee evaluation criteria to place a greater emphasis on ethical conduct and compliance. By rewarding employees who demonstrate a high level of integrity and ethical behavior, Nomura aims to foster a culture where such values are paramount. This shift in evaluation processes is intended to send a clear message that ethical behavior is integral to career advancement and recognition within the company.

To support this cultural shift, Nomura Holdings is also investing in comprehensive compliance and ethics training programs for its employees. These training sessions will cover a wide range of topics, including the importance of ethical conduct, recognizing and reporting misconduct, and understanding the legal and regulatory frameworks that govern their operations. By equipping employees with the necessary knowledge and skills, the firm aims to empower them to act with integrity and uphold the highest standards of professional conduct.
